Output 64301487d86b60d27c0057ba460f09fc142a8b31f492e91e614014f5cd4fbb02:16

value
376649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8016f90270831ac1d0605e61820f4f4734ad423e OP_EQUAL
address
3DNHwGYQTpiasn6YdjvgTvxLFM8Zopebxe
transaction
64301487d86b60d27c0057ba460f09fc142a8b31f492e91e614014f5cd4fbb02
spent
true